    Four top notch 7" roots rockers from Joe Gibbs / Studio 16 originally released in the late 70s & early 80s. Featuring Sylford Walker, Junior Murvin, Naggo Morris & Glen Washington with dubs by Errol Thompson & Joe Gibbs aka The Mighty Two. All four singles come in thick card colour sleeves..nice!
